British artist Martin Creed made the first version of his text-based sculpture Work No. 3398 EVERYTHING IS GOING TO BE ALRIGHT in 1999. One of his most iconic works, variations of the site-responsive neon continue to appear in different sizes and colors throughout the world. The sculpture is emblematic of Creed’s artistic practice, which uses language, ordinary materials, and everyday interventions to communicate with the larger public. Commissioned for moCa’s Gund Commons, Creed’s Work No. 3398 EVERYTHING IS GOING TO BE ALRIGHT (2020) is a single line of unpunctuated text rendered in rainbow neon. The work’s simple statement  ‘EVERYTHING IS GOING TO BE ALRIGHT’ stretches across an expanse of wall, revealing itself as you enter the museum. Creed’s sculpture is at once a hopeful, familiar, and reassuring phrase, and a gentle nod to the challenges lying ahead amid the current uncertainties.
